SEARS-COLLINS, Justice.

Lionel Bernard Dennis was convicted in Dougherty County Superior Court of felony murder, two counts of armed robbery, possession of a firearm by a convicted felon, possession of firearm during the commission of a felony, and possession of cocaine.1 He was sentenced to twenty years for each armed robbery, five years for possession of a firearm by a convicted felon, life for...
